Case Study 6

Tower Anchors
i

U.S. Cellular

Location: Communications Towers upgrades
Owner: US Cellular
Formerly known as Prime-Co Cellular

Problem

Demand for cellular communications exceeded capabilities of existing towers requiring additional antenna equipment to be installed on existing towers, which in turn would exceed the design capabilities of the towers to withstand wind loads.

Solution

HGS installed a series of A.B. Chance Helical Anchors® adjacent to the existing anchoring system of towers; guy wire systems were transferred to chance anchors thereby increasing the load bearing capacities of the existing towers.  Work was performed on a series of towers on the Florida Turnpike originating at Leesburg and extending all the way to the upper Keys.  Tower upgrades were performed within the budget and time constraints of the projects owners.
